- Title
Investigation of the Polytypism in Layered CdInGaS<sub>4</sub> Crystals by Electron Diffraction Methods.
- Authors
Kyazumov, M. G.; Rzayeva, S. M.; Avilov, A. S.
- Abstract
The polytypism in layered CdInGaS4 crystals grown by chemical transport reaction has been investigated by previously developed methods of oblique-texture electron diffraction and electron diffraction rotation for single crystals. It is shown that, along with the known 1T, 2H, and 3R polytypes, the 3T and 6R polytypes are identified incorrectly when using oblique-texture electron diffraction. A single-crystal rotation study revealed that the 3T polytypes are mixtures of the 1T and 3R polytypes and the 6R polytypes are mixtures of the 2H and 3R polytypes. Different polytypes alternate strictly in the direction perpendicular to the layers. The advantages of the electron diffraction rotation in comparison with other diffraction methods in phase and structural diagnostics of polytype mixtures are shown.
